ZIP Code 14712 is a ZIP Code Tabulation Area in Chautauqua County, New York, home to about 3,079 residents. Its median household income of $77,423 runs above the Chautauqua County figure of $56,507.
From 2019 to 2023, ZIP Code 14712's population grew 1.1% from 3,044 to 3,079, while its median gross rent fell 4.8% from $814 to $775.
Owners occupy 90.5% of the area's occupied homes. The median resident is 58.4 years old.

| Year | Population | Median household income | Median home value | Median gross rent |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2019 | 3,044 | $66,250 | $162,300 | $814 |
| 2020 | 3,051 | $63,567 | $163,800 | $843 |
| 2021 | 2,817 | $65,179 | $179,400 | $730 |
| 2022 | 3,089 | $74,464 | $203,300 | $785 |
| 2023 | 3,079 | $77,423 | $219,000 | $775 |
Each year is a US Census Bureau ACS 5-year estimate ending that year.
